  • What types of projects do you work on?

    Winter Jones works across a broad range of projects, from small residential schemes and creative commissions through to branding and digital work for businesses. While the outputs vary, the approach is always the same: thoughtful, design-led, and tailored to the individual project rather than a fixed formula.

    We’re particularly well suited to projects where care, collaboration, and clarity matter.

    Do you work on small projects?

    Yes — many of our projects are relatively small in scale. We believe good design isn’t defined by size or budget, and smaller projects often benefit the most from careful thinking and clear guidance.

    If your project feels modest but important to you, it’s still worth getting in touch.

    Where are you based, and where do you work?

    Winter Jones is based in Ruthin, North Wales and we work primarily across North Wales and the North West of England. That said, some creative and digital projects can be undertaken remotely, depending on the brief.

    If you’re unsure whether your location is suitable, feel free to ask.

    How does the process usually work?

    Every project starts with a conversation. From there, we’ll help define the brief, understand your priorities, and outline a clear process tailored to the work involved.

    We place a strong emphasis on clear communication, realistic timescales, and making sure you understand each step before moving forward.

    Do you offer an initial consultation?

    Yes. An initial conversation is always encouraged and is typically informal and exploratory. It’s an opportunity for you to explain what you’re hoping to achieve and for us to advise on next steps, feasibility, and whether we’re the right fit for each other.

    There’s no obligation to proceed beyond this stage.

    How do fees work?

    Fees vary depending on the scope, complexity, and timescale of the project. Wherever possible, we aim to provide clear, fixed fees for defined stages of work.

    We’re always upfront about costs and will explain what is included, what isn’t, and where additional services may be required so there are no surprises later on.

    What if I’m not sure exactly what I need yet?

    That’s very common. Many clients come to us with an idea rather than a fully formed brief.

    Part of our role is helping you clarify what you need, challenge assumptions where appropriate, and explore options before any major decisions are made.

    Do you work with other consultants or contractors?

    Yes. Depending on the project, we often collaborate with trusted consultants, builders, and specialists. Where relevant, we can help coordinate input and advise on when additional expertise is required.

    Can you help with planning, approvals, or technical requirements?

    Where applicable, we can guide you through the relevant processes, explain what’s required, and help prepare the necessary information.

    We aim to make what can feel like a complicated system clearer and less intimidating.

    How long do projects usually take?

    Timescales vary significantly depending on the nature of the project and external factors. At the outset, we’ll give you a realistic indication of likely durations and key milestones, and we’ll keep you informed as things progress.

    We’re honest about what can be controlled — and what can’t.

    Do you take on every enquiry?

    No — and that’s intentional. We’re selective about the projects we take on to ensure we can give each one the time, care, and attention it deserves.

    If we’re not the right fit, we’ll always be open about that and, where possible, point you in a helpful direction.

    How do I get started?

    The best place to start is simply by getting in touch via the contact form or email. A short overview of your idea, site, or challenge is more than enough to begin the conversation.

    From there, we’ll take things step by step.
